What Is Diagnostic Imaging?
Diagnostic imaging refers to non-invasive procedures used to create detailed images of the body's internal structures. These imaging techniques help detect diseases, monitor injuries, and guide medical procedures.
Importance of Diagnostic Imaging:
Early disease detection before symptoms become severe.
Accurate diagnosis for better treatment planning.
Non-invasive assessment with minimal discomfort.
Guidance for medical procedures such as biopsies or surgeries.
Ongoing monitoring of chronic conditions or post-treatment recovery.
Types of Diagnostic Imaging Available
Various imaging techniques are used based on the medical condition being examined. Each type has unique benefits and applications.
X-Rays
X-rays are one of the most commonly used imaging methods, particularly for detecting bone fractures and lung conditions.
Common Uses:
Identifying fractures, dislocations, and joint damage.
Detecting pneumonia or lung infections.
Locating foreign objects inside the body.
Evaluating dental health.
Computed Tomography (CT) Scans
CT scans provide detailed cross-sectional images of the body, offering greater clarity than standard X-rays.
Common Uses:
Diagnosing tumors, infections, and internal bleeding.
Assessing head injuries, including strokes and brain swelling.
Evaluating abdominal pain and organ abnormalities.
Guiding biopsies and other medical procedures.
Magnetic Resonance Imaging (MRI)
MRI scans use strong magnetic fields and radio waves to generate highly detailed images of soft tissues, organs, and joints.
Common Uses:
Detecting brain and spinal cord disorders.
Evaluating ligament and cartilage injuries.
Diagnosing tumors or cysts in organs.
Examining heart and blood vessel conditions.
Ultrasound
Ultrasound uses high-frequency sound waves to create real-time images of organs and tissues.
Common Uses:
Monitoring pregnancy and fetal development.
Evaluating heart function and blood flow.
Examining abdominal organs for cysts, tumors, or stones.
Diagnosing soft tissue injuries.
Mammography
Mammograms are specialized X-ray exams designed to detect breast abnormalities.
Common Uses:
Screening for early signs of breast cancer.
Evaluating lumps or changes in breast tissue.
Detecting calcium deposits that may indicate precancerous conditions.
Nuclear Medicine Imaging
Nuclear imaging involves using radioactive tracers to highlight specific areas of the body.
Common Uses:
Detecting thyroid disorders.
Identifying bone fractures or infections.
Evaluating heart conditions and blood flow.
Diagnosing certain cancers.

Preparation
Preparation depends on the type of imaging being performed. Patients may be asked to:
Avoid eating or drinking for several hours before certain scans.
Wear loose, comfortable clothing without metal components.
Remove jewelry or metal accessories that may interfere with imaging.
Inform the technician about any medical conditions, allergies, or pregnancy.
During the Procedure
Patients may need to lie still on a table while images are taken.
Some procedures involve contrast dye to enhance image clarity.
Imaging duration varies, with some tests taking only a few minutes while others may last up to an hour.
A radiology technician will guide the patient through the process.
After the Procedure
Results are analyzed by a radiologist and sent to the referring physician.
Most imaging tests require no recovery time.
Some procedures, like contrast-enhanced scans, may require increased fluid intake to help clear the dye from the body.

Safety Considerations for Diagnostic Imaging
While most imaging procedures are safe, there are a few precautions to consider.
Radiation Exposure
X-rays and CT scans use small amounts of radiation but are generally safe.
MRI and ultrasound do not use radiation, making them suitable for frequent use.
Pregnant women should inform healthcare providers before any imaging.
Contrast Dye Reactions
Some patients may experience mild allergic reactions to contrast agents.
Hydration helps flush contrast dye from the body after the procedure.
Severe reactions are rare but should be reported immediately.

FAQs
How long does a diagnostic imaging test take?
The duration depends on the type of imaging. X-rays typically take a few minutes, while MRI scans can last up to an hour.
Is diagnostic imaging painful?
Most imaging tests are painless. Some procedures may involve slight discomfort, such as holding still for an extended period or receiving an injection of contrast dye.
Do I need a referral for diagnostic imaging?
Most imaging tests require a physician's referral to ensure the appropriate test is conducted for the patient's condition.
Are there risks associated with diagnostic imaging?
While some imaging techniques involve minimal radiation exposure, the benefits generally outweigh any risks. MRI and ultrasound do not use radiation.
How soon will I receive my imaging results?
Results are usually available within 24 to 48 hours, depending on the type of test and the facility's processing time.
